Software Engineer (Remote)

Description KBX Technology Solutions, LLC, a provider of transportation technology to industry leaders, is seeking an early career Software Engineer. This role will be part of a team of engineers that are responsible for enhancing existing applications and for building applications using modern microservices architecture techniques. Responsibilities include the implementation of technical solutions that are secure, support best practices, embrace CI/CD, and are scalable. The qualified candidate has a solid understanding of the organization(s) being supported and ITs role in the business's mission and applies it to the application development and design. KBX Technology Solutions is a subsidiary of KBX - a Koch Industries Inc. company - and complements all KBX subsidiaries (Rail, Logistics, and International) to drive enhanced data and analytics across the global supply chain for customers. Based in Wichita, Kansas, Koch Industries is one of the largest privately held companies in America. Being privately held, we are able to embrace long-term visions and invest in the future through our holistic application of Market-Based Management . What You Will Do In Your Role Work independently, or within the construct of a product team, to understand customer and business requirements to deliver creative solutions which meet or exceed those business needs. Execution of this role will involve both the deployment of standardized product offerings and the creation of new solutions and services as required to meet customer needs. Maintain awareness of emerging industry trends and technologies which may create value. Produce documentation to support solutions that you have developed in order to aid in support of the solution - perform on-call support as needed. Performing analysis and development of Web-based front-end applications. Working with a team of engineers and analysts through discovery, delivery, and support of new platforms that are focused on the transformation of our transportation management systems. Ensuring delivery of technical solutions that meet the business outcomes, consistent with software development standards and best practices for a service-oriented architecture. Develop, test, and deploy solutions based on requirements. The Experience You Will Bring Requirements:
Degree in Computer Science/MIS, Engineering, or equivalent experience Experience with modern object-oriented development language like Python, C#.NET, Go, Scala, Java or Swift Experience developing RESTful APIs Experience with website development using modern web frameworks like Angular, Vue or React, SCSS, Sass, or CSS Experience taking designs and recreating with HTML and CSS What Will Put You Ahead Experience writing unit tests Experience with Onion, N-TIER, Hexagonal or other formal architectural strategy Experience utilizing SOLID Development Patterns Understanding of Microservice vs Monolithic architecture Experience utilizing Message Queueing Technologies such as RabbitMQ or Kafka Experience setting up applications to build in a Docker Container Experience working with AWS Experience working with Angular 2

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
